automated storage tiering (AST)
Automated storage tiering (AST) is a storage software management feature that dynamically moves information between different disk types and RAID levels to meet space, performance and cost requirements. Definition
-
information life cycle management (ILM)
Information life cycle management (ILM) is a comprehensive approach to managing the flow of an information system's data and associated metadata from creation and initial storage to the time when it becomes obsolete and is deleted. Definition
-
tiered storage
Tiered storage is the assignment of different categories of data to different types of storage media in order to reduce total storage cost. Definition
